The hard truth is, print production errors rarely stem from a single point of failure at the final output stage. Most are rooted deep in the creative and pre-production workflow. The printer is often the last to see the file, and the first to feel the heat when something’s wrong.
1. The Myth of the Perfect File Hand-off
You’ve probably heard it: “Just send a print-ready PDF.” Sounds simple, right? It’s the common assumption that if you export a PDF with the right settings, the job is done. You’ve done your part.
But a “print-ready” PDF is a complex beast. It’s not just about resolution and bleed. It’s about understanding the entire chain from design software to the final press. Most teams, even experienced ones, are flying blind on many crucial details.
Color Spaces Are Not Universally Understood
RGB vs. CMYK is the classic example. You designed in RGB because your screen looks great. But print uses CMYK. Converting is necessary, but *how* you convert, and *when*, matters immensely. Are you using the correct profiles for the intended print process (e.g., SWOP, GRACoL)? Or are you letting software make a generic conversion that shifts colors unexpectedly?
This isn’t just about brightness. It’s about gamut. What looks vibrant on your screen might be impossible to reproduce in CMYK, leading to muddy, disappointing results. Relying on the printer to “fix” this is asking them to guess your original intent, which is a recipe for disaster.
Fonts Are Landmines
Did you embed them? Outline them? Are they licensed for embedding? These questions are often overlooked. When fonts aren’t properly handled, they substitute, reflow text, or disappear entirely. Suddenly, your carefully typeset layout is a mess.
Transparency and Overprint Quirks
Complex layering, drop shadows, and blending modes can behave unpredictably when flattened for print. What looks fine in Adobe Illustrator or Photoshop might render differently in a print RIP (Raster Image Processor). Understanding how these elements flatten and interact with spot colors or specific ink combinations is critical.
Bleed and Trim are Not Suggestions
Designing right to the edge of your artboard without accounting for bleed is a common mistake. When the printer trims the stock, white edges appear. Conversely, placing critical elements too close to the trim line means they risk being cut off.

2. The Pre-Press Black Hole
Between the design file and the printing press lies pre-press. This is where files are checked, corrected, and prepared for the specific printing technology. It’s a crucial gate, but often, it’s under-resourced or misunderstood by the design team.
Manual Checks Are Inconsistent
Many agencies rely on a quick visual check by a designer or project manager before sending the file. This is woefully inadequate. Humans miss things. Automated preflight checks in software like Acrobat Pro are better, but they aren't foolproof and require proper configuration.
Lack of Specialized Knowledge
Pre-press requires expertise. Knowing about trapping, imposition, ink densities, dot gain, and specific press requirements for different paper stocks is specialized knowledge. Expecting every designer or account manager to possess this is unrealistic.
The Printer’s Pre-Flight as a Last Resort
When a printer performs pre-flight checks, it’s often because the file failed basic requirements. They might catch obvious errors, but they aren’t paid to redesign your file or guess your intentions. Their checks are often focused on technical viability, not aesthetic perfection. If they find issues, they’ll flag them, but the clock is ticking, and charges for corrections can mount quickly.
Communication Breakdowns
When pre-press issues arise, the communication between the agency, the client, and the printer can become a tangled mess. Misunderstandings about who is responsible for what, and how much time/cost is involved, lead to frustration and delays.
3. The Illusion of “Proofing”
You get a digital proof. You approve it. Then the final print comes back wrong. What happened?
Digital proofs (like PDFs or soft proofs) are essential, but they are not perfect representations of the final printed piece. They have limitations:
Color Gamut Differences
Your monitor, even if calibrated, cannot perfectly replicate the color gamut of CMYK printing or specific spot colors (like Pantone). A digital proof might look acceptable on screen, but the actual printed colors could be significantly duller or shifted.
Material Simulation Fails
A PDF proof doesn’t show you how the ink will look on the actual paper stock. Will it be glossy, matte, textured? These properties affect color perception and overall appearance. A proof on coated stock won’t accurately represent the result on uncoated, for example.
Lack of Tactile Feedback
Print is a tactile medium. The weight of the paper, the finish, the embossing – these elements are lost in a digital proof. Approving a digital file means you’re approving a flat, intangible representation.
Hard Proofs Aren’t Always Practical
While a calibrated hard proof (a physical printout from a specialized printer) is more accurate, it’s expensive and time-consuming. Many projects, especially those with tight turnarounds or smaller budgets, skip this step. Relying solely on digital proofs or a quick glance at a press sheet is a gamble.
The Approval Process Itself
Are approvals being handled systematically? Is it clear who has the final say? Are feedback loops documented? Vague approvals, or approvals based on incomplete understanding of proof limitations, are a major source of error.
4. The Hidden Variables: Substrate and Finishing
You designed for a glossy brochure, but it printed on matte paper. Or you expected a clean die-cut, but the edges are rough. These issues often get lumped under “print errors,” but they originate earlier.
Paper Choice Matters
Different paper stocks absorb ink differently, have different brightness levels, and affect color reproduction. Choosing a paper without considering its interaction with the ink and the final design can lead to unexpected results. The printer might substitute a similar stock if the specified one isn't available, and without clear communication, this substitution might not be flagged until it's too late.
Finishing Effects Are Production Steps
Die-cutting, embossing, foil stamping, lamination – these aren't just decorative additions. They are production processes with their own tolerances and potential pitfalls. If the die-lines aren't correct, or if the artwork isn't set up to accommodate the finishing technique, errors will occur.
Environmental Factors
Humidity, temperature, and even the physical handling of materials can impact print quality. While printers strive to control these, extreme conditions can cause issues like curling, ink set-off, or color shifts.

4. The Hard Truth: It’s About Process, Not Just People
The printer isn’t the sole villain. Nor is the designer. The problem is rarely a single person’s mistake; it’s a systemic breakdown in process, communication, and knowledge sharing.
The assumption that print production is straightforward, or that “the printer will fix it,” leads to a reactive rather than proactive approach. This reactive mode is expensive, stressful, and damaging to client relationships.
The real solution lies in building robust workflows that anticipate potential issues:
- Standardized Templates: Use templates with pre-set bleed, color profiles, and guides.
- Pre-flight Checklists: Develop internal checklists for file preparation that go beyond basic export settings.
- Clear Communication Protocols: Define how and when to communicate with printers about specifications, proofs, and potential issues.
- Proofing Best Practices: Educate your team and clients on the limitations of digital proofs and the value of hard proofs when necessary.
- Continuous Learning: Stay updated on printing technologies, paper types, and finishing techniques.
Treating print production as a complex, multi-stage process requiring careful management at every step is the only way to consistently achieve high-quality results and avoid costly errors.

What’s the difference between a digital proof and a hard proof?
A digital proof (like a PDF) is a screen representation and has limitations in color accuracy and material simulation. A hard proof is a physical printout made using calibrated equipment that more closely simulates the final printed output, including color and paper stock, but is more expensive and time-consuming.
